If everyone in the country used the same voting system then any statistical bias in that system affects every vote. You are voting via web page? It could come down to the instruction wording; page colors, fonts, graphics, background... who knows what could have a statistical effect.
For the same reason there should not be a Starbucks on every street corner in the world. Because if they start using a "special sauce" that causes cancer or the like, the whole world gets hammered.
The strength resulting from our non-centralized and locally varied government should not be overlooked.
